Come with us on a journey of discovery as we uncover new and powerful healing states full of wonder and possiblity, and then show you how to use these techniques for yourself! From these healing states, we expand into the realm of emotional healing, self-discovery, and the philosophical and spritual implications of a fundamentally flexible reality. In this book you will learn -Enter a wondrous state of being for powerful energy healing. -Rediscover your true self through feeling and wonder. -Free yourself from the drama in your life. -Be fully immersed in joy. -Solve problems in unique and wondrous ways. -Use life's challenges as a tool to set you free. -Dream a whole new reality into being. -Find balance and even enlightenment.
